Understanding the House Edge in Roulette
Before diving into strategies, it’s essential to grasp the house border in roulette, as it directly impacts your long-term chances. European roulette, with a single zero, has a house edge of 2.70%, making it the most favourable choice for players. This means that for every $100 wagered, the casino expects to keep $2.70 on average out, while the user gets back $97.30. The single zero reduces the casino’s vantage compared to American roulette, which has both a single zero and a look-alike zero. French roulette, also with a single zero, offers an even lower house edge of 1.35% on even-money bets due to the ‘en prison’ or ‘la partage’ rules, which return half your post if the ball lands on cypher. Under ‘en prison’, the stake is imprisoned for the next spin; if it wins, the player gets the original stake back without profit. With ‘la partage’, half the bet is now returned. These rules effectively cut the domiciliate border in half for even-money bets same red/black, odd/even out, or high/low. American roulette, with its doubled zero (00) in addition to the single zero (0), has a significantly higher house edge of 5.26% on most bets, making it much less favourable. The extra pocket increases the total number of slots to 38 (1-36, 0, 00) instead of 37 in European roulette, skewing the odds further in the casino’s favour. For example, a straight-up punt a single number pays 35 to 1, but the true odds are 37 to 1 in European roulette and 38 to 1 in American roulette, giving the domiciliate its sharpness. Live roulette typically follows European or French rules, as these are standard in most online casinos, but the house sharpness remains the same as its land-based counterparts, so players should e’er check the rules before playing. Some live dealer games may offer special face bets with higher house edges, so it’s wise to stick to standard bets. Knowing these differences helps you choose the redress variant and set realistic expectations for your bankroll. For instance, a punter with a $100 funds playing European roulette can expect to lose about $2.70 per $100 wagered over time, while the same funds in American roulette would lose $5.26 per $100, effectively halving the playing time. Understanding the house edge also helps in selecting betting strategies, as some systems like the Martingale rely on even-money bets, where the lower house border of French roulette can be particularly beneficial.

Common questions about casino roulette live app answered.
What is the difference between European and American roulette?
European roulette has a single cypher, giving the house a 2.70% edge, while American roulette includes a image zero, increasing the house border to 5.26%.
How do betting options bear on the house edge in roulette?
Inside bets ilk straight-ups feature higher payouts but lower odds, while outside bets like red/black provide nearly 50% win chances but lower payouts; the house edge remains constant per wheel type.
What is the RTP for European roulette?
The theoretical RTP for European roulette is 97.30%, meaning for every £100 wagered, you can anticipate £97.30 back on average over the long term.
What is a beginner strategy for roulette?
A simple strategy is to stick to outside bets (e.g., cherry-red/ignominious, odd/even) with nearly 50% win probability, and utilize a flat betting approach to manage your balance.
How does live roulette differ from standard online roulette?
Live roulette features a real dealer and physical wheel streamed in cash time, offering a thomas more immersive experience, while received online roulette uses a random number generator for virtual spins.

Tips for Safe and Enjoyable Roulette Sessions
Gambling is strictly for adults aged 18 and over. In the UK, all licensed operators are regulated by the Gambling Commission (UKGC). If you experience you need to occupy a break, you can self-exclude via GAMSTOP, which covers all UKGC-licensed sites. For support, contact GamCare or BeGambleAware on the National Gambling Helpline at 0808 8020 133. Ever set deposit and time limits before you play, and remember that gambling should be for entertainment only—never chase losses.
